Abstract
PURPOSE:To obtain a composite spun yarn in which fibers of finite length are entangled uniformly in a core yarn at a high speed, by providing an air flow zone where the flow velocity of the core yarn is increased to the running direction thereof in a false twisting zone of the core yarn, and introducing opened fibers of finite length into the air flow zone. CONSTITUTION:A fibrous group 3 of finite length is introduced from a suction inlet 9 into an air flow controlling zone 4 forming a tapered path to increase the air flow velocity gradually in the running direction of a fleece 1, conveyed by a twisted yarn together thereon, twisted and mostly collected by the twisted yarn in the air flow controlling zone 4 while being oriented in parallel with the forward direction. The fleece 1 becomes a core yarn in an untwisting zone of false twisting nozzle 5 by the difference in the twisting density, and a composite spun yarn (Y) in which fibers of finite length in the fibrous group 3 are wound around the fleece 1 is obtained.
